66 Clapham High Street, London, SW4 7UL
78 Clapham High Street, London, SW4 7UL
Aquum, 68-70 Clapham High Street, London, England, SW4 7UL
86-90 Clapham High Street, Clapham High Street, London, England, SW4 7UL
80 Clapham High Street, London, SW4 7UL
72 Clapham High Street, London, England, SW4 7UL
72 Clapham High Street, London, United Kingdom, SW4 7UL
60 Clapham High Street, London, United Kingdom, SW4 7UL
126 Clapham High Street, London, England, SW4 7UL
100 Clapham High Street, London, England, SW4 7UL
62 Clapham High Street, London, United Kingdom, SW4 7UL
80 Clapham High Street, London, England, SW4 7UL
64 Clapham High Street, London, England, SW4 7UL
98, Flat C,, Clapham High Street, London, England, SW4 7UL
100a Clapham High Street, London, Lambeth, England, SW4 7UL
102-104 Clapham High Street, London, England, SW4 7UL
Popular Companies
Latest Companies
Copyright © 2025. All rights reserved.